I respect the gentleman's comments, and I respect the gentleman. He mentioned many of the functions that are necessary for the government that we should be doing. The one he didn't mention was defending the security of the United States. That is one of the fundamental purposes of the Federal Government. What this amendment would do is take money out of the program to continue the life extension program of the W80 warhead, the only cruise missile in the U.S. nuclear arsenal. The gentleman says we don't need it now, so let's spend the money somewhere else; and if we need it next year, I guess we can just spend the money next year. But you can't develop this, and you don't do these life-extension programs in just a year. These are long-term investments. The life extension program will replace the nonnuclear and other components to support the Air Force's plan to develop the long-range standoff cruise missile, or the LRSO. If the gentleman believes the LRSO is not necessary, I would point him at the Air Force, whose leadership has testified on numerous occasions before Congress that we need to sustain our nuclear capabilities and we need to make these investments. We must do the work that is needed to extend the life of this warhead as long as there is a clear defense requirement for maintaining a nuclear cruise missile capability.…
